23. Fiction at the Intermediate Level - More Than Just Reading
University essay from Sektionen för humaniora (HUM)Abstract : Purpose: Investigate how fiction can be used in the intermediate school in order to give the students a chance to reach goals in the curriculum and the syllabus. Question formulation: How is fiction used today in order to reach goals in the syllabus and curriculum? How can fiction be used to reach the goals? Method: I have read three fictional books which are used in the intermediate school at two schools today and analysed how these books can be useful to be able to reach goals considering democracy, equality and fair treatment.
